The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system

The problem of optimizing the transmission capacity of a pipeline network is important for ensuring its operability. The problem arises at different stages of the network life cycle (design, optimization, development). The problem is to determine the diameters of the pipelines, the locations of the...

Full description

Bibliographic Details
Main Authors: Stennikov Valery, Sokolov Dmitry, Barakhtenko Evgeny
Format: Article
Language:English
Published: EDP Sciences 2020-01-01
Series:E3S Web of Conferences
Subjects:
Online Access:https://www.e3s-conferences.org/articles/e3sconf/pdf/2020/79/e3sconf_mmmaosdphs2020_02005.pdf
_version_ 1819182275616571392
author Stennikov Valery
Sokolov Dmitry
Barakhtenko Evgeny
author_facet Stennikov Valery
Sokolov Dmitry
Barakhtenko Evgeny
author_sort Stennikov Valery
collection DOAJ
description The problem of optimizing the transmission capacity of a pipeline network is important for ensuring its operability. The problem arises at different stages of the network life cycle (design, optimization, development). The problem is to determine the diameters of the pipelines, the locations of the pumps and the heads on them, the locations of the regulators (flow and pressure) and their parameters. The article proposes a new algorithm based on dynamic programming, which implements an original approach to organizing a computational procedure. The general principles of the algorithm and the content of its steps do not depend on the purpose of the network and the composition of its equipment. The algorithm is versatile and allows one to optimize networks for various purposes. The proposed algorithm is implemented in the IRNET software. On its basis, calculations were made for the development of real district heating systems.
first_indexed 2024-12-22T22:43:33Z
format Article
id doaj.art-fefdd285bd7f4e9aaa4ab44e0304111c
institution Directory Open Access Journal
issn 2267-1242
language English
last_indexed 2024-12-22T22:43:33Z
publishDate 2020-01-01
publisher EDP Sciences
record_format Article
series E3S Web of Conferences
spelling doaj.art-fefdd285bd7f4e9aaa4ab44e0304111c2022-12-21T18:10:08ZengEDP SciencesE3S Web of Conferences2267-12422020-01-012190200510.1051/e3sconf/202021902005e3sconf_mmmaosdphs2020_02005The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line systemStennikov Valery0Sokolov Dmitry1Barakhtenko Evgeny2 Melentiev Energy Systems Institute of SB RAS (ESI SB RAS) Melentiev Energy Systems Institute of SB RAS (ESI SB RAS) Melentiev Energy Systems Institute of SB RAS (ESI SB RAS)The problem of optimizing the transmission capacity of a pipeline network is important for ensuring its operability. The problem arises at different stages of the network life cycle (design, optimization, development). The problem is to determine the diameters of the pipelines, the locations of the pumps and the heads on them, the locations of the regulators (flow and pressure) and their parameters. The article proposes a new algorithm based on dynamic programming, which implements an original approach to organizing a computational procedure. The general principles of the algorithm and the content of its steps do not depend on the purpose of the network and the composition of its equipment. The algorithm is versatile and allows one to optimize networks for various purposes. The proposed algorithm is implemented in the IRNET software. On its basis, calculations were made for the development of real district heating systems.https://www.e3s-conferences.org/articles/e3sconf/pdf/2020/79/e3sconf_mmmaosdphs2020_02005.pdfpipeline networkoptimization algorithmsnetwork optimizationpipeline diameterspumpsdynamic programming
spellingShingle Stennikov Valery
Sokolov Dmitry
Barakhtenko Evgeny
The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
E3S Web of Conferences
pipeline network
optimization algorithms
network optimization
pipeline diameters
pumps
dynamic programming
title The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
title_full The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
title_fullStr The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
title_full_unstemmed The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
title_short The development of an algorithm based on dynamic programming for optimization of tree-like energy pipeline system
title_sort development of an algorithm based on dynamic programming for optimization of tree like energy pipeline system
topic pipeline network
optimization algorithms
network optimization
pipeline diameters
pumps
dynamic programming
url https://www.e3s-conferences.org/articles/e3sconf/pdf/2020/79/e3sconf_mmmaosdphs2020_02005.pdf
work_keys_str_mv AT stennikovvalery thedevelopm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em
AT sokolovdmitry thedevelopm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em
AT barakhtenkoevgeny thedevelopm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em
AT stennikovvalery developm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em
AT sokolovdmitry developm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em
AT barakhtenkoevgeny developmentofanalgorithmbasedondynamicprogrammingforoptimizationoftreelikeenergypipelinesystem